Domantas Sabonis continues to make 20-rebound games look easy.
The Sacramento Kings’ center secured 21 rebounds during Wednesday’s 134-120 win over the Los Angeles Lakers, marking the big man’s second-straight game with 20 boards or more.
Sabonis’ 21 rebounds were part of a triple-double stat line that included 13 points and 12 assists as the 26-year-old’s All-Star campaign continued in style.

The big man became the first player with 75 rebounds and 30 assists over a four-game span since Wes Unseld did so in 1970. The only other players to accomplish that feat are Elgin Baylor, Wilt Chamberlain, Bill Russell & Maurice Stokes, per Elias Sports Bureau.

The Sacramento Kings entered the 2022-23 season hoping to break a 16-year playoff drought. After hiring Mike Brown as the team’s new coach, the Kings drafted Keegan Murray with the number four overall pick. They continued to make moves over the summer, trading for Kevin Huerter and signing multiple free agents, including guard Malik Monk.
